Grenada has about 113,000 people in the latest estimate. St George’s is the capital; Gouyave, Grenville, Victoria, Sauteurs and Hillsborough are principal communities. Six parishes share the country with Carriacou and Petite Martinique.
Grenada’s national flower is the bougainvillea, celebrated for the brilliant bracts that surround its small white flowers. It appears in many colours and thrives as a sunny hedge, climbing vine, pot plant or hanging display. The flower also enters Grenada’s official imagery: sprays of bougainvillea frame the seven roses representing the country’s parishes on the national crest.
